+static bool access_attributes_only(uint32_t access_mask,
+                                  uint32_t open_disposition)
+{
+       switch (open_disposition) {
+       case NTCREATEX_DISP_SUPERSEDE:
+       case NTCREATEX_DISP_OVERWRITE_IF:
+       case NTCREATEX_DISP_OVERWRITE:
+               return false;
+       default:
+               break;
+       }
+#define CHECK_MASK(m,g) ((m) && (((m) & ~(g))==0) && (((m) & (g)) != 0))
+       return CHECK_MASK(access_mask,
+                         SEC_STD_SYNCHRONIZE |
+                         SEC_FILE_READ_ATTRIBUTE |
+                         SEC_FILE_WRITE_ATTRIBUTE);
+#undef CHECK_MASK
+}
